首页 > 编程知识 正文

自从我学会了换行

时间:2023-11-20 07:14:46 阅读:289290 作者:LCOJ

本文将从多个方面对于换行的使用进行详细的阐述,希望能够帮助大家更好地掌握此功能。

一、换行的概念

换行,指的是在文本输入时,按下回车键使光标跳到下一行的操作。在编写文本文档、邮件、论文、编程等场景中,常常需要使用换行操作。

在HTML、CSS等语言中,也可以通过特定的标签或者样式实现换行的效果。例如,在HTML中可以使用<br>标签来进行换行,在CSS中可以使用white-space属性来实现想要的换行效果。

二、在普通文本中如何使用换行

在普通文本中,可以通过回车键或者换行符(n)来进行换行。具体来说,不同的操作系统可能会有不同的换行符表示方式。在Windows系统中,通常使用的是“rn”(回车+换行)表示换行;在Unix或者Linux系统中,使用的是“n”表示换行;而在Mac OS Classic系统中,使用的则是“r”表示换行。

除了使用回车键或者换行符来进行换行之外,有些文本编辑器或者处理工具,也可以使用一些快捷键或者组合键实现换行。例如,在微软的Word处理软件中,可以使用快捷键“Ctrl+Enter”实现换行的操作。

三、HTML中的换行

在HTML中,可以使用<br>标签来进行换行。用法非常简单,只需要在需要进行换行的位置插入<br>标签即可。

<div>
  这是一段需要换行的文字<br>
  这是一段需要换行的文字
</div>

以上代码片段中,“<div>”标签内的两段文字都需要进行换行。因此,在第一行的文字后面插入了一个<br>标签,从而使它换行。

四、CSS中的换行

与HTML不同,CSS并不提供显式的换行标签。不过,可以通过控制元素的盒子模型和文本流来实现想要的换行效果。

最常用的是使用“word-break”和“word-wrap”属性来控制单词的换行。这两个属性主要是用来控制单个单词过长时是否会被截断并换行。例如,可以将“word-wrap”属性设置为“break-word”来实现单词过长时的换行:

p {
  word-wrap: break-word;
}

此外,还可以使用“white-space”属性来控制元素内的空白符处理方式。默认情况下,HTML文档会忽略多余的空白符,将它们简单地合并为一个空格。如果需要在元素内保留原本的空白符,则可以将“white-space”属性设置为“pre”:

div {
  white-space: pre;
}

五、在编程中如何使用换行

在编程中,换行是一个非常常见的操作。在不同的编程语言中,换行的实现方式也可能会有所不同。

在Python中,可以使用“n”字符来表示换行符。例如:

print("Hellonworld")

以上代码片段中,输出的结果是“Hello”和“world”分别占一行,中间用一个换行符分隔。

在C语言中,也可以使用“n”字符来表示换行符。不过,由于C语言还有一些额外的输出函数,因此换行的实现方式更加灵活。例如,使用printf函数来输出两行字符串:

#include <stdio.h>

int main()
{
  printf("Hellon");
  printf("worldn");

  return 0;
}

以上代码片段中,通过使用两次printf函数,一次输出“Hello”,一次输出“world”,从而实现了换行的效果。

六、总结

本文从多个方面对于换行的使用进行了详细的阐述。在实际的应用场景中,无论是在文本编辑、网页设计还是编程开发中,都需要掌握好换行的操作。希望本文能够对大家有所启发和帮助。

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。